So while starting to sort out this year's calendar, I thought I would have a quick look back on our 2015.
We had 104 appointments for Dexter; Cerebral Palsy reviews in Sydney, CT scans, Pediatrician appointments, Dentist visits, Surgery, Orthotics reviews, Hospital stays, Emergency room visits, an Ambulance ride, Occupational Therapy sessions, Speech therapy sessions, Physiotherapy sessions, Vision appointments, Surgical reviews, Doctor visits and CP appointments.
The girls needed 18 hospital or doctor appointments: for hearing appointments for Kaisa and fracture clinics for Charlotte, plus immunisations and dentist visits for them both and then the occasional Dr review too...
I needed 11 appointments, including ultrasounds on my wrist and stomach, xrays and blood tests.
I can't remember the last time I slept more than 3 hours straight!
This isn't a complaint post or me asking for pity!
It's just an insight into my life and the reason I like coffee and chocolate... and the occasional scotch!
